Latest Patents
Jenna holds 1 patent for her invention titled "Methods for treating medical conditions by anti-type 2 therapy." This patent outlines methods and materials involved in treating medical conditions, specifically focusing on the use of anti-Interleukin 4, anti-Interleukin 5, and/or anti-Interleukin 13 antibodies. These methods are designed to treat asthma in mammals identified as having a Th2 immune response, utilizing a whole blood cell-based cytokine assay.
